    My first trip on the AT was with two of my friends and we did the 75 miles between Troutdale, VA and the Tennessee State Line.

    It was a experience that has never let go now ever year I take one of my vacations to hike the AT, I suggest that everyone who loves the outdoors at least do a section hike somewhere on the trail. At the top of Mt. Rogers (Virginias Highest Point) the woods turns into open field that’s full of wild ponies that just roam around without a care in the world.

    On the Trail we ran into some of the nicest people who talked to us like we were old friends from suggests on how to make the AT easier to the everyday trials and tribulations of life. It was amazing !!!!!

    Chances are that of your on the east coast you have a part of the AT near you somewhere. So take a weekend loop hike!!!! Its sweet
